Hello! I'm Kyle! I'm a Computer Science student who graduated in December 2025. Notably, I've worked on a handful of projects over the years, ranging from some full stack development to game development.
-
Monumenta: A Minecraft "CTM MMO RPG" server that has been in development since June 2016. I joined the development team back in August 2024, and have since then become a Core Contributor. I have worked on plugins for the server, which are programmed in Java. I also have worked with Minecraft function files and other types of
.jsonfiles. Some additions I have worked on include the following:- Work for the in-game "Seasonal Pass" system, featuring a missions and rewards track. This work includes simplifying mission creation by creating a web-based (HTML) tool to generate mission and rewards JSON files which can be found in Monumenta's ScriptedQuests Repository.
- Helped lead and create in-game events, such as yearly Halloween and Christmas events, as well as the 10th Anniversary event celebrating the occasion back in June 2026
- In-game items, such as an enchantment allowing for "signing" an item based on a player name or a guild name, a storage container for "charm" items, and many other tweaks and features.
- Many bug fixes. Like, a lot of them. It's a rite of passage for any type of game development, even plugin development!
- All of this work can be found on Monumenta's Public Repository, submitted as merged pull requests.
-
Transaction Tracker Application: A full-stack budgeting application developed from database, to microservice, to frontend/backend in a team within the months of August 2025 to December 2025.
- Tools used for this project include GitHub (version control), Figma, SQL, MariaDB (database), Angular (frontend), and Java Spring Boot (backend).
- The repository for the UI of this project can be found here. Linked within this repository are also other resources used for the API.


